ST. JOE'S TO CELEBRATE 25TH ANNIVERSARY THIS JULY.
On July 4-5-6 St. Joe's will celebrate its 25th Anniversary. We are hoping that all former students will be able to attend the events planned for the July weekend. The reunion central website is up and running and nearly complete. We hope you will be able to pay and register by the end of January or early February. Planning for St. Joe's reunion is underway. The alumni have created a committee being led by Mrs. Tammy Delorme (nee McDonald). The event will be held July 4-6, 2008. A brand new website has been created to keep alumni up-to-date on planning for this event. You can visit the website at www.sjss25.com.

GET YOUR YEAR OFF TO A GOOD START
If you encounter any problems with your classes try out "ASK A TEACHER" a valuable resource provided by the Independent Learning Centre. The website offers FREE online tutoring and homework help for Grades 9-12. Chat rooms are available Sunday to Thursday from 5:30pm to 9:30 pm where you can connect live with certified Ontario teachers for one-on-one help. You can check out the website by clicking here.
